条件判断表达式是为了实现控制流,也就是判断在不同的条件下执行不同的流程。
MySQL中提供了三种条件判断函数:IF()、IFNULL()与CASE。本文就逐一对其逻辑及使用方法进行探索。
转载
2023-07-13 10:18:22
155阅读
# 判断MySQL数据库中是否存在用户
在MySQL数据库中,我们经常需要判断某个用户是否存在。这对于权限管理和安全性非常重要。本文将介绍如何通过SQL语句来判断MySQL数据库中是否存在指定的用户。
## 为什么要判断用户是否存在
在实际开发中,我们需要确保数据库中的用户是合法、存在的。判断用户是否存在可以帮助我们避免不必要的错误和数据泄露。另外,对于权限管理和安全性来说,及时发现和删除非
原创
2024-03-28 05:39:11
85阅读
根据某一条件从数据库表中查询 『有』与『没有』,只有两种状态,那为什么在写SQL的时候,还要select count(*)呢?无论是刚入道的程序员新星,还是精湛沙场多年的程序员老白,都是一如既往的count.目前多数人的写法多次 review 代码时,发现如现现象:业务代码中,需要根据一个或多个条件,查询是否存在记录,不关心有多少条记录。普遍的SQL及代码写法如下SQL写法:SELECT coun
转载
2021-06-08 15:58:51
171阅读
# Java中利用if判断是否存在的方法
在Java编程中,我们经常需要根据某些条件来判断变量是否存在。这个过程通常可以利用if语句来实现。在本文中,我们将介绍如何使用if语句来判断变量是否存在,并提供一些代码示例来帮助读者更好地理解。
## 判断变量是否存在的方法
在Java中,我们通常可以使用以下方法来判断变量是否存在:
1. 使用if语句判断变量是否为null。
2. 使用if语句判
原创
2023-12-18 11:01:25
95阅读
# 在 MySQL 中使用 JOIN 处理“不存在”的情况
在数据库管理中,处理不同表之间的关系是一个常见的需求。在 MySQL 中,`JOIN` 操作可以帮助我们有效地从多个表中获取数据。然而,在实际应用中,我们可能会遇到某些情况,希望找到在一个表中存在但在另一个表中不存在的记录。本文将通过一个示例,介绍如何使用 `LEFT JOIN` 和 `WHERE IS NULL` 来实现这一目标。
原创
2024-10-16 04:22:11
92阅读
## MySQL 如果存在用户删除
MySQL 是一个常用的关系型数据库管理系统,用于存储和管理数据。在使用 MySQL 进行开发和运维的过程中,我们经常需要创建、修改和删除数据库用户。本文将介绍如何使用 MySQL 删除已存在的用户,并提供相应的代码示例。
### 什么是 MySQL 用户?
在 MySQL 中,用户是通过用户名和密码来进行身份认证的。每个用户可以被授予特定的权限,以控制对
原创
2023-10-29 04:41:31
62阅读
最近在开发一个电商平台的时候,经常会遇到要判断表中是否存在某条记录,不存在,则插入。判断记录是否存在的sql,不同的写法,也会有不同的性能。select count(*) from tablename where col = 'col';
select count(*) from tablename where col = 'col';这种方法性能上有些浪费,没必要把全部记录查出来。select
转载
2023-06-08 15:27:54
249阅读
在信息技术行业,数据库的安全性是一个关键问题。尤其是在使用 MySQL 数据库时,用户的空密码问题屡屡引发安全隐患。为了保证数据的安全性,我决定对 “MySQL 存在用户空密码问题整改” 进行详细的分析和解决方案的整理。
### 背景描述
随着信息科技的迅速发展,数据库系统在各类应用中发挥着越来越重要的角色。根据最近的调查,在 2022 年至 2023 年之间:
1. 超过 30% 的企业数
一、背景在使用MySQL进行插入的时候,遇到了一个场景:当插入的数据不再数据库中的时候就插入,否则就跳过。二、方法我们可以使用下面的SQL语句进行处理,处理语句如下。在这个里面有几个重要的地方,DUAL和insert的操作。标准:INSERT INTO table (primarykey, field1, field2, ...)
SELECT key, value1, value2, ...
F
转载
2024-02-19 00:17:37
58阅读
Mysql使用Describe命令判断字段是否存在
工作时需要取得MySQL中一个表的字段是否存在 于是就使用Describe命令来判断 mysql_connect('localhost', 'root', 'root'); mysql_select_db('demo'); $test = mysql_query('Describe cdb_posts first'); $test = mysql
转载
2023-06-07 11:51:12
551阅读
根据某一条件从数据库表中查询 『有』与『没有』,只有两种状态,那为什么在写SQL的时候,还要select count(*) 呢?无论是刚入道的程序员新星,还是精湛沙场多年的程序员老白,都是一如既往的count.目前多数人的写法多次 review 代码时,发现如现现象:业务代码中,需要根据一个或多个条件,查询是否存在记录,不关心有多少条记录。普遍的SQL及代码写法如下SQL写法:SELECT cou
转载
2020-12-17 16:04:42
635阅读
一、 引言 Mycat作为现在最流行的分布式数据库中间件,已经在很多的生产项目中实施,随着时间的推移会有更多的生产项目中会用到Mycat。 本文主要是介绍MyCat主要配置文件,以及笔者对这些配置的一些理解。二、 前言本文主要分析的有server.xml,schema.xml,rule.xml三个最常用的文件。三、 Server.xmlServer.xml保存了mycat需要的所有的系统配置信息
# 判断MySQL列是否存在的方法
## 1. 总览
在MySQL开发中,有时候需要判断某个表中是否存在指定的列。本文将详细介绍如何判断MySQL列是否存在的方法,通过表格展示整个过程,并提供每一步所需的代码以及相应的注释。
## 2. 判断MySQL列是否存在的步骤
下面是判断MySQL列是否存在的步骤,我们将通过表格的形式展示出来。
| 步骤 | 操作 |
| --- | --- |
原创
2023-08-26 09:08:51
227阅读
## 实现 "mysql if 判断数据存在" 的步骤
### 整体流程
以下是实现 "mysql if 判断数据存在" 的整体流程:
```mermaid
journey
title mysql if 判断数据存在
section 准备工作
查询数据是否存在
section 判断结果
section 实现方案
```
### 步骤详解
#### 准
原创
2024-02-03 09:26:41
84阅读
# MySQL 判断字段存在
在实际的开发过程中,经常会遇到需要判断数据库表中某个字段是否存在的情况。特别是在进行数据库升级或者处理老数据时,我们需要先确认某个字段是否存在,再进行相应的操作。本文将介绍如何使用 MySQL 来判断字段是否存在,并给出相应的代码示例。
## 判断字段存在的方法
在 MySQL 中,我们可以通过查询 `information_schema` 数据库中的 `COL
原创
2024-03-23 05:53:47
72阅读
# MySQL函数判断存在的实现方法
## 1. 整体流程
下面是实现“MySQL函数判断存在”的整体流程表格:
| 步骤 | 描述 |
| --- | --- |
| 步骤一 | 连接到MySQL数据库 |
| 步骤二 | 创建数据库 |
| 步骤三 | 创建存储过程 |
| 步骤四 | 判断函数是否存在 |
| 步骤五 | 关闭数据库连接 |
接下来,我们将逐步介绍每个步骤需要做的事情,
原创
2023-08-29 10:23:54
142阅读
# MySQL 判断表存在的方法
## 概述
在 MySQL 数据库中,有时候我们需要判断一个表是否存在。本文将教你如何使用 SQL 语句来判断表是否存在,并给出了详细的步骤和代码示例。
## 流程图
```mermaid
graph TD
A[开始] --> B[连接数据库]
B --> C[执行SQL语句]
C --> D[处理查询结果]
D --> E[判断表是否存在]
E --> F
原创
2023-09-03 17:24:30
86阅读
# 如何判断MySQL中是否存在汉字
## 概述
在MySQL中,判断是否存在汉字是一个比较常见的需求,尤其是对于需要处理中文数据的应用程序。在本文中,我将向你展示如何在MySQL中实现对汉字的判断。这将包括整个过程的步骤以及每一步需要执行的操作和代码示例。
## 流程
以下是实现“MySQL存在汉字判断”的流程:
```mermaid
journey
title 实现“MySQ
原创
2024-06-16 05:39:31
26阅读
运行机制流程图1. 建立连接(Connectors&Connection Pool),通过客户端/服务器通信协议与MySQL建立连 接。MySQL 客户端与服务端的通信方式是 “ 半双工 ”。对于每一个 MySQL 的连接,时刻都有一个 线程状态来标识这个连接正在做什么。通讯机制:全双工:能同时发送和接收数据,例如平时打电话。半双工:指的某一时刻,要么发送数据,要么接收数据,不能同时。例如
转载
2023-09-05 18:23:04
89阅读
# MySQL中的INSERT INTO语句与判断存在
在MySQL中,INSERT INTO语句用于将数据插入到数据库表中。然而,在插入数据之前,我们有时候需要先判断该数据是否已经存在于表中。本文将介绍如何使用INSERT INTO语句来判断数据的存在性,并提供相应的代码示例。
## INSERT INTO语句的基本用法
在开始之前,我们先来了解一下INSERT INTO语句的基本用法。I
原创
2023-11-02 07:17:44
196阅读